Should Oranges Be In Fridge. For maximum flavor and juiciness, oranges should be eaten within a few days of purchasing. Oranges in the fridge will stay fresh for up. But if you have to store them, refrigerating the citrus is the best way to prevent moisture loss and maintain texture and flavor. In the freezer, you can stretch it out to almost a year. Any oranges left on the counter for several days should be transferred to the fridge if not eaten. Oranges and tangerines keep best in cold places—to maximize quality, the crisper drawer in your fridge will prove most fruitful.
